Re: BC Bolts on BRC's
I have owned well over 125 WW2 jeeps and trailers over 30 years and almost all of the BC bolts I have found came from WW2 trailers. I own and am in the process of restoring a 1941 Bantam BRC and most of the bolts on that are TR, TR over A or TR over 20 marked. I also see A and AA marked bolts on the BRC.
When the restoration of my BRC started a few years ago it was one of the last "known" unrestored/untouched BRC's left and I did not see one BC marked bolt and I was paying attention.
This is not gospel but my observation.

Re: BC Bolts
Tim,
I’m restoring a Dec ‘42 MB for SWMBO.
All 20 of the oil pan bolts I’ve just removed are “B C” marked.
All the bolts on my 1944 Bantam are “A” or “E C” marked as are most of the bolts on my ‘44 MB.
